I am a new pool owner, had it built just last month.

I have a 23K gallon rectangular pool with a swg.

I tested the following levels with a Taylor K-2006 Kit.

FC - 3.6ppm
CYA - over 100
TA - 130
Ph - 7.6


I am worried about the CYA and TA levels.

Suggestions from the pro's please??
 
TA is nothing to worry about and will find its happy spot just from keeping the pH in range.

Biggest concern is the high CYA. Anything over 100ppm can register as that. You could try the test with a 50/50 mix of pool and tap water and then double the result to get a better idea. Best solution is replacing water to get down into the recommended range.

Right now your FC is way too low for that high of a CYA. Check out the CYA/FC chart in Pool School.

Edit: I see the SWG mentioned so the FC may not be way too low but it is still a little too low. Certainly don't want algae to start at that high CYA, so at a minimum get your FC up some more.

CYA is not naturally occurring. It has been added to the pool and at 120, is really almost unmanageably high.

You can get rid of it only by draining off a percentage of your water. I would suggest a 33% drain which should get it to 80 when you refill which is at the very high end of manageable.

With a CYA of 80, you can dial in your SWG to maintain FC around 4-6ppm and you should be fine the rest of the season.
 
Well tap water does not have CYA ... So someone added it.

Draining about a third of the water to lower the CYA to 80ppm is the best option ... Although if the water is clear, you could probably get by leaving it high for the rest of the season if you maintain the FC above 6ppm at all times. Maybe target 8ppm to be safer. Although if algae starts, you will have to drain to lower the CYA.

As you adjust the pH, which will drift up due to the SWG and TA, the TA will drop everyone you add acid. Simplest to just watch the pH.

Posted from my Droid with Tapatalk ... sorry if my response is short ;)
 
Unless you drain some of the water, likely you will have very close to the cya level you have now when you open again in the spring. It will be a little lower due to back washing between now and then, and any addition of rain, etc can dilute it if you have to drain some of the water due to it getting too high. Generally though, cya doesn't get used up or disappear.

You may be able to manage it if you keep your FC levels at the recommended levels for the 120 range and just wait for it to naturally come down with back washing. It will mean you have to use more chlorine or probably run your swg for longer amounts of time, but if water is a big expense there... and I'm assuming it is... it is an option. Just don't get lazy and let your FC drift down too low or you'll have quite a lot of chlorine to lug around to shock your pool. :shock:
